A capsule wardrobe is a seasonal wardrobe you curate with a select number of pieces that you can pair with each other. You’ll choose shirts that go with all your bottoms, dresses that match your sweaters, etc. so that you get the most out of your wardrobe.
You can choose a number of items that feels good for you. Though, there are particular versions of the capsule wardrobe like Project 333, which is 33 pieces of clothing for three months.
Capsule wardrobes have a lot of pros, like helping you curb your clothes spending. It also ensures that you love all your clothes and it all feels and look good on you. You can eliminate all that excess stuff that sits in your closet untouched anyway.
One of the cons is that when you create a capsule wardrobe, you repeat the same items often. And an important way to keep it interesting and fun is through pairing accessories with your wardrobe.
